Sinaimountain - Outside Sharm el Sheikh
Egypt holds some of finest historical and natural attractions around the world, which attracts many of the tourists towards it and the Sinai Mountain, is one of those. Sinai Mountain comes after Mount St. Catherine in terms of height and is the second largest mountain peak in Sinai Peninsula, Egypt. Sinai Mountain is also known by many other names as well and those are Mount Musa, or Mount Horeb or Moses Mountain or Gebel Musa. Sinai Mountain is about 2,285 meter high and is near Ras Sasafeh.
Sinai Mountain is called Moses Mountain because of its religious history and being the pilgrimage destination. It is said that god spoke to Moses here at Sinai Mountain and since then it has been the major attraction for the tourists coming to Egypt and holds a great religious spot in the hearts and minds of the locals and tourists of Egypt.
There is a small Chapel on the peak of Sinai Mountain and is dedicated to Holy Trinity. The chapel is named Burning Bush, and was built in 1934 on the ruins of ancient 16th century church. It is said that the chapel holds the rock from which God created the table of law. This attracts a lot of religious tourists coming to Egypt.
Tourist’s loves to climb the Mountain Sinai and if you too are planning for it then keep in mind that, to climb the 7.498-foot peak takes about 3hours to climb. After this there is a stairway of about 4,000 steps. So if you should evaluate your physical condition before deciding to climb it on your own. The stunning sunrise and Sunset view are the other reasons which makes people to climb the mountain on their own and when you are going for it don’t forget to bring good Hiking shoes and plenty of water with you. The water is must and you must not forget it at any cost.
Though there are other ways as well to climb Mount Sinai and that is with the help of camels or by road trips. Both of the ways can be arranged with the help of your hotel and many of the people prefers this way of reaching the peak of Sinai Mountain. Spending a night there and watching an early sunrise is a common thing which people visiting the Sinai mountain do and it surely is a once in a life time opportunity.
